The Race School covers everything from the basics of kart control to more advanced racing techniques. You learn about braking points, how to choose the best racing line, ways to position your body in the kart for better cornering, and tips for overtaking safely. There are also sessions explaining the difference between dry and wet weather driving, plus advice on how to build your confidence on track. A lot of drivers see their lap times improve even after their first session, but how quickly you get faster depends on your starting point and how much you practise. With focused training, most people notice real progress in a few sessions, especially if they put what they learn into use during open karting or practice sessions.

The adult karts can reach speeds of up to 50mph. There are different karts for adults and juniors: adult drivers use TBKart R25 270cc karts, while juniors, starting from eight years old, use the TBKart R13 160cc karts designed to be safe and suitable for younger drivers. Both options offer reliable performance, but the junior karts are a bit lighter and slower to make sure they are safe for less experienced racers.

Go karting sessions run in all weather, including light rain, as many drivers enjoy the extra challenge and the karts are designed to handle wet track conditions. If weather becomes unsafe, such as with heavy rain or standing water, staff will assess the track to decide if it is safe to continue. If conditions are too dangerous and the session needs to be stopped, it may be postponed and rescheduled for another date. Refunds are not usually given for wet weather but bookings are moved to a later session free of charge if the track cannot be used safely. Safety is always the priority, and updates are given as soon as decisions are made.
